Yograj Singh’s new controversy
Former cricketer and actor Yograj Singh, who is the father of World Cup champion Yuvraj Singh, has once again landed in controversy. An FIR has been registered against him in Chandigarh, which is to a viral scene from Amazon Prime Video’s web series ‘Lukhkhe’. It is alleged that derogatory dialogues towards women have been said in this series. After this case escalated, Yograj has applied for anticipatory bail in the court.
cause of dispute
The controversy started with a scene in the ‘Lukhkhe’ web series, in which Yograj Singh’s character said something about a female police officer, which was considered against the dignity of women. After this video went viral on social media, it was strongly criticized. Chandigarh lawyers Ujjwal Bhasin and Jatin Verma filed a complaint in this case.
case in court
After the FIR, Yograj Singh moved the court and sought anticipatory bail. His lawyer argued that he was only playing a fictional character and acting as per the script. The court has issued a notice to the state government seeking its response, and the next hearing is likely to be held on May 20.
Victor Singh’s reaction
Yograj Singh’s younger son Victor Singh has refused to comment on the matter. He said that the family is taking legal advice on this issue and do not want to make any hasty statement. Victor also said that actors often work within the confines of the script, but did not provide any clarity on the controversial dialogue.
